Test::Deep::YAML - A Test::Deep plugin for comparing YAML-encoded data
version 0.004
use Test::More; use Test::Deep; use Test::Deep::YAML; cmp_deeply( "---\nfoo: bar\n", yaml({ foo => 'bar' }), 'YAML-encoded data is correct', );
This module provides the yaml function to indicate that the target can be parsed as a YAML string, and should be decoded before being compared to the indicated expected data.
yaml
Contains the data which should match corresponding data in the "got" structure after it has been YAML-decoded.
